作者:朱金灿

来源:http://blog.csdn.net/clever101

在创建hudson账户和分配权限时出错,当单击save按钮时出现

HTTP Status 500 -

type Exception report

message

description The server encountered aninternal error () that prevented it from fulfilling this request.

exception

hudson.security.AccessDeniedException2:anonymous is missing the Administer permission

hudson.security.ACL.checkPermission(ACL.java:52)

hudson.model.Node.checkPermission(Node.java:356)

hudson.Functions.checkPermission(Functions.java:557)

sun.reflect.GeneratedMethodAccessor289.invoke(UnknownSource)

s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

java.lang.reflect.Method.invoke(Method.java:597)

org.apache.commons.jexl.util.introspection.UberspectImpl$VelMethodImpl.invoke(UberspectImpl.java:258)

org.apache.commons.jexl.parser.ASTMethod.execute(ASTMethod.java:104)

org.apache.commons.jexl.parser.ASTReference.execute(ASTReference.java:83)

org.apache.commons.jexl.parser.ASTReference.value(ASTReference.java:57)

org.apache.commons.jexl.parser.ASTReferenceExpression.value(ASTReferenceExpression.java:51)

org.apache.commons.jexl.ExpressionImpl.evaluate(ExpressionImpl.java:80)

hudson.ExpressionFactory2$JexlExpression.evaluate(ExpressionFactory2.java:72)

org.apache.commons.jelly.parser.EscapingExpression.evaluate(EscapingExpression.java:24)

org.apache.commons.jelly.impl.ExpressionScript.run(ExpressionScript.java:66)

org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95)

org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95)

org.kohsuke.stapler.jelly.ReallyStaticTagLibrary$1.run(ReallyStaticTagLibrary.java:99)

org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95)

org.kohsuke.stapler.jelly.ReallyStaticTagLibrary$1.run(ReallyStaticTagLibrary.java:99)

org.apache.commons.jelly.impl.ScriptBlock.run(ScriptBlock.java:95)

org.apache.commons.jelly.tags.core.CoreTagLibrary$2.run(CoreTagLibrary.java:105)

org.kohsuke.stapler.jelly.CallTagLibScript.run(CallTagLibScript.java:119)

org.apache.commons.jelly.tags.core.CoreTagLibrary$2.run(CoreTagLibrary.java:105)

org.kohsuke.stapler.jelly.JellyViewScript.run(JellyViewScript.java:63)

org.kohsuke.stapler.jelly.DefaultScriptInvoker.invokeScript(DefaultScriptInvoker.java:63)

org.kohsuke.stapler.jelly.DefaultScriptInvoker.invokeScript(DefaultScriptInvoker.java:53)

org.kohsuke.stapler.jelly.JellyFacet$1.dispatch(JellyFacet.java:89)

org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:573)

org.kohsuke.stapler.Stapler.invoke(Stapler.java:658)

org.kohsuke.stapler.Stapler.invoke(Stapler.java:489)

org.kohsuke.stapler.Stapler.service(Stapler.java:160)

javax.servlet.http.HttpServlet.service(HttpServlet.java:717)

h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:94)

org.hudsonci.servlets.internal.ServletRegistrationFilterAdapter.doFilter(ServletRegistrationFilterAdapter.java:180)

org.hudsonci.servlets.internal.ServletRegistrationFilterAdapter.doFilter(ServletRegistrationFilterAdapter.java:148)

h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:97)

org.hudsonci.servlets.internal.ServletRegistrationFilterAdapter.doFilter(ServletRegistrationFilterAdapter.java:180)

org.hudsonci.servlets.internal.ServletRegistrationFilterAdapter.doFilter(ServletRegistrationFilterAdapter.java:148)

h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:97)

hudson.util.PluginServletFilter.doFilter(PluginServletFilter.java:86)

hudson.security.csrf.CrumbFilter.doFilter(CrumbFilter.java:47)

h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:84)

hudson.security.ChainedServletFilter.doFilter(ChainedServletFilter.java:76)

hudson.security.HudsonFilter.doFilter(HudsonFilter.java:164)

hudson.util.CharacterEncodingFilter.doFilter(CharacterEncodingFilter.java:81)

note The full stack trace of the root causeis available in the Apache Tomcat/6.0.32 logs.

原因是权限配错了,anonymous也没有read权限你尝试先取消权限设置,在config.xml中把下面这行
<useSecurity>true</useSecurity>
改成
<useSecurity>false</useSecurity>

再重新配置权限,就应该可以了。

hudson搭建经验总结(三)的更多相关文章

  1. hudson搭建经验总结

    作者:朱金灿 来源:http://blog.csdn.net/clever101 hudson 是一种革命性的开放源码 CI (持续集成)服务器,随着工程源码越来越庞大,把源码编译工作放在本地机器已不 ...

  2. hudson搭建经验总结(二)

    作者:朱金灿 来源:http://blog.csdn.net/clever101 继续部署hudson,发现从google上的一个开源工程上:http://code.google.com/p/huds ...

  3. 【转2】Appium 1.6.3 在Xcode 8 (真机)测试环境搭建 经验总结

    Appium 1.6.3 在Xcode 8 (真机)测试环境搭建经验总结 关于 Appium 1.6.3 在Xcode 8, 1真机上环境搭建问题更多,写此文章,供大家参考,让大家少走弯路. 在开始i ...

  4. 【转1】Appium 1.6.3 在Xcode 8, iOS 10.2(模拟器)测试环境搭建 经验总结

    Appium 1.6.3 在Xcode 8, iOS 10.2(模拟器)测试环境搭建 经验总结 关于 Appium 1.6.3 在Xcode 8, 10.2 的iOS模拟器上的问题很多,本人也差点放弃 ...

  5. 使用Hudson搭建自动构建服务器

    环境: ubuntu1404_x64 说明: 使用hudson和git搭建自动构建服务器的简单示例 安装hudson及相关插件 安装hudson 安装命令如下: sudo sh -c "ec ...

  6. CentOS7 搭建Kafka(三)工具篇

    CentOS7 搭建Kafka(三)工具篇 做为一名懒人,自然不喜欢敲那些命令,一个是容易出错,另外一个是懒得记,能有个工具就最好了,一查还挺多,我们用个最主流的Kafka Manager Kafka ...

  7. ibatis 开发中的经验 (三)Struts+Spring+Ibatis 开发环境搭建

             ibatis项目中用到了一些基本配置,须要和spring集成,看了看这些配置大部分同hibernate中是一样的,也比較好理解.仅仅是须要他们的配置中每个类的含义,还有当中的一些细节 ...

  8. c#项目架构搭建经验

    读过.Net项目中感觉代码写的不错(备注1)有:bbsMax(可惜唧唧喳喳鸟像消失了一样),Umbraco(国外开源的cms项目),Kooboo(国内做开源cms).本人狭隘,读的代码不多,范围也不广 ...

  9. Mongodb副本集搭建经验

    一.环境配置经验 1.一般安装的副本集的时候,主实例可以有数据库和用户:从实例不能.仲裁机不能有任何数据库包括用户 2.搭建副本集的时候Host使用外网IP,否则使用Mongodb VUE 1.6.9 ...

随机推荐

  1. poj 3100 (zoj 2818)||ZOJ 2829 ||ZOJ 1938 (poj 2249)

    水题三题: 1.给你B和N,求个整数A使得A^n最接近B 2. 输出第N个能被3或者5整除的数 3.给你整数n和k,让你求组合数c(n,k) 1.poj 3100 (zoj 2818) Root of ...

  2. POJ 3159 Candies 还是差分约束(栈的SPFA)

    http://poj.org/problem?id=3159 题目大意: n个小朋友分糖果,你要满足他们的要求(a b x 意思为b不能超过a x个糖果)并且编号1和n的糖果差距要最大. 思路: 嗯, ...

  3. [AngularFire 2] Joins in Firebase

    Lets see how to query Firebase. First thing, when we do query, 'index' will always help, for both SQ ...

  4. The behavior of App killed or restored by Android System or by users

    What's the behavior of App killed or restored by Android System or by users? First, user kills the a ...

  5. Android之RecyclerView简单使用(三)

    使用过ListView滴小伙伴都知道.ListView有这样一个属性android:divider,用来设置每一个item之间切割线滴属性.问题来了,那么RecyclerView这个控件有没有这个属性 ...

  6. 15.1 linux操作系统下nand flash驱动框架2

    当我们需要在操作系统上读写普通文件的时候,总是需要一层层往下,最终到达硬件相关操作,当然底层设备大多数都是块设备 NAND FLASH就作为一个最底层的块设备. 而写驱动,就是要构建硬件与操作系统之间 ...

  7. java痛苦学习之路[十二]JSON+ajax+Servlet JSON数据转换和传递

    1.首先client须要引入 jquery-1.11.1.js 2.其次javawebproject里面须要引入jar包  [commons-beanutils-1.8.0.jar.commons-c ...

  8. 反向代理:是指以代理server来接收Internet上的请求,然后将请求转发到内部网络的server上,并将结果返回给Internet上连接的client,此时的代理server对外就表现为反向代理server。

       Nginx安装好之后.開始使用它来简单实现反向代理与负载均衡的功能.在这之前.首先得脑补一下什么是反向代理和负载均衡.   反向代理:是指以代理server来接收Internet上的请求,然后将 ...

  9. 【PHP】php 递归、效率和分析(转)

    递归的定义 递归(http:/en.wikipedia.org/wiki/Recursive)是一种函数调用自身(直接或间接)的一种机制,这种强大的思想可以把某些复杂的概念变得极为简单.在计算机科学之 ...

  10. 【2001】关于N!的问题

    Time Limit: 3 second Memory Limit: 2 MB 编写程序,计算n!以十进制数形式表示的数中最右边一个非零数字,并找出在它右边有几个零. 例如:12!=1*2*3*4*5 ...